AGI partners with Agilent Technologies for improved virtual flight testing of radar systems



Extensive flight testing using physical aircraft is prohibitively expensive, especially in today’s tight financial times. Further adding to the complexity, the results from one flight run to the next are not repeatable, due to factors such as speed attitude, pilot awareness and Sun angle. To ensure the most effective use of resources, it is essential to evaluate flight scenarios in advance of live tests. Combining the capabilities of AGI’s Systems Tool Kit (STK) and Agilent’s SystemVue software to perform virtual flight testing enables repeatable testing and hundreds of “what if” scenarios. SystemVue models the signal generation, DSP and radio frequency (RF) processing, while STK models the aircraft profile, flight dynamics and propagation. This allows the testing of multiple radar scenarios with your existing, or proposed, system—quickly and repeatedly.
